Police arrest suspect in robbery

A Windsor man is facing several charges after a robbery at home in downtown Windsor Tuesday.

Police said the victim reported that a man he knew came into his home on Wyandotte Street West near Church Street with what looked like a gun and threatened him. The man demanded the victim hand over several items. The man left when other people in the home intervened.

The robbery was reported to Windsor police on Wednesday after the victim reported being threatened over the phone.

Police located a suspect and he was arrested without incident.  Police found a black pellet gun through the investigation.

Mario Angelo, 20, is facing charges of robbery, threats to cause death, and possessing an imitation weapon for the purpose of committing a crime. The charges have not been proven in court.
